+// SunJSSE does not support dynamic system properties, no way to re-use
+// system properties in samevm/agentvm mode.
+
+/*
+ * @test
+ * @summary Test jdk.tls.server.protocols with DTLS
+ * @run main/othervm -Djdk.tls.server.protocols="DTLSv1.0"
+ *      CustomizedDTLSServerDefaultProtocols
+ */
+
+import java.security.NoSuchAlgorithmException;
+import java.security.Security;
+import java.util.Arrays;
+import java.util.HashSet;
+import java.util.Set;
+
+import javax.net.SocketFactory;
+import javax.net.ssl.SSLContext;
+import javax.net.ssl.SSLEngine;
+import javax.net.ssl.SSLParameters;
+import javax.net.ssl.SSLServerSocket;
+import javax.net.ssl.SSLServerSocketFactory;
+import javax.net.ssl.SSLSocket;
+
+public class CustomizedDTLSServerDefaultProtocols {
+
+    final static String[] supportedProtocols = new String[]{
+            "DTLSv1.0", "DTLSv1.2"};
+
+    enum ContextVersion {
+        TLS_CV_01("DTLS",
+                new String[]{"DTLSv1.0"},
+                supportedProtocols),
+        TLS_CV_02("DTLSv1.0",
+                supportedProtocols,
+                new String[]{"DTLSv1.0"}),
+        TLS_CV_03("DTLS1.2",
+                supportedProtocols,
+                supportedProtocols);
+
+        final String contextVersion;
+        final String[] serverEnabledProtocols;
+        final String[] clientEnabledProtocols;
+
+        ContextVersion(String contextVersion, String[] serverEnabledProtocols,
+                String[] clientEnabledProtocols) {
+            this.contextVersion = contextVersion;
+            this.serverEnabledProtocols = serverEnabledProtocols;
+            this.clientEnabledProtocols = clientEnabledProtocols;
+        }
+    }
+
+    private static boolean checkProtocols(String[] target, String[] expected) {
+        boolean success = true;
+        if (target.length == 0) {
+            System.out.println("\tError: No protocols");
+            success = false;
+        }
+
+        if (!protocolEquals(target, expected)) {
+            System.out.println("\tError: Expected to get protocols " +
+                    Arrays.toString(expected));
+            success = false;
+        }
+        System.out.println("\t  Protocols found " + Arrays.toString(target));
+        return success;
+    }
+
+    private static boolean protocolEquals(
+            String[] actualProtocols,
+            String[] expectedProtocols) {
+        if (actualProtocols.length != expectedProtocols.length) {
+            return false;
+        }
+
+        Set<String> set = new HashSet<>(Arrays.asList(expectedProtocols));
+        for (String actual : actualProtocols) {
+            if (set.add(actual)) {
+                return false;
+            }
+        }
+
+        return true;
+    }
+
+    private static boolean checkCipherSuites(String[] target) {
+        boolean success = true;
+        if (target.length == 0) {
+            System.out.println("\tError: No cipher suites");
+            success = false;
+        }
+
+        return success;
+    }
+
+    public static void main(String[] args) throws Exception {
+        // reset the security property to make sure that the algorithms
+        // and keys used in this test are not disabled.
+        Security.setProperty("jdk.tls.disabledAlgorithms", "");
+        System.out.println("jdk.tls.client.protocols = " +
+                System.getProperty("jdk.tls.client.protocols"));
+        System.out.println("jdk.tls.server.protocols = "+
+                System.getProperty("jdk.tls.server.protocols"));
+        Test();
+    }
